Foxy 200 fraction collector

The Foxy 200 is our best selling fraction collector. They are really quite robust. Unlike the Foxy JR they have a sturdy dispensing arm. The main weakness is in the X axis belt which we often find broken in Foxy 200s liquidated in auctions. The other cause for concern is solvent damage beneath the drip pan. The drip pan does have a drain but if it becomes plugged the solvent can overflow and be pulled under the pan and above the collector's main body(A.K.A chassis). If the solvent remains trapped inside the results can be disastrous. We have had to scrap several Foxy 200s that we purchased due to solvent damage here. Worst yet it is hard to avoid repeating these kinds of purchases as the solvent damage is largely concealed. The damage is however a real cause for concern. We have seen examples were the solvent has "eaten" right through the main body.

This being said, overall the Foxy 200 is a great fraction collector. The Foxy 200 is also very flexible. There are a wide variety of programing options and many racks available. There are also extra valve options. There is a 'safety' valve option that that interrupts the flow while the dispensing arm is moving between tubes. This is handy if your samples are precious or dangerous. Even better is the 'diverter' valve which is a 3 way valve. The Foxy 200 can discard non-peak to a waste funnel but this is less then ideal as there is a possibility of cross contamination and does not work with certain racks such as the microplate rack. The 'diverter' valve allow non peak to be sent to a separate waste line without the arm having to move at all. If you need to collect and immense about of samples you can even chain multiple Foxy 200s together in series and have the 'diverter' switch the flow to another Foxy 200 after the first Foxy 200's racks are full. In addition there are multi-column dispensing heads that allow completely parallel flows to be collected from multiple columns.

As mentioned, the Foxy 200 has many programming options. In fact there are more options then the newer R1 and R2 fraction collectors that are meant to super cede it, specifically the time windows options.

The Foxy 200 can be remotely controlled via RS-232. If you require  it, we can write custom computer programs. We can also modify them if you have a special application.

There are a large number of racks that can be used with this fraction collector. We have many used racks in stock.

The Foxy 200 can be controlled through RS-232 or through contact closure. We can offer them with event cables for contact closure control and peak measurement. We also offer the RS232 cables.
